Abstract

Extraction of actinides has been examined in two-phase aqueous systems based on poly(ethylene glycol) (PEG) from sulfate solutions in the presence of potassium phosphotungstate, which forms strong complexes with ions of tri- and tetravalent transuranium elements. Extraction of these complexes by aqueous PEG solution is complete in contrast to that of penta- and hexavalent actinides. Conditions have been chosen for the separation of actinides in different oxidation states.
